Crow/Ka’qaquj
Crow/Ka’qaquj is a campsite in Halifax, Halifax Region, Nova Scotia. Crow/Ka’qaquj is situated nearby to Upper Marsh Lake, as well as near the peak Mi’kmaw Hill.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hubley
Hubley is a residential community within the Halifax Regional Municipality, Nova Scotia on Trunk 3 between Upper Tantallon and Timberlea approximately 15 kilometres from Halifax.Bayers Lake Business Park
